感觉神经听力损失在耳硬化手术中
Kristýna Néma1,2,3, Viktor Chrobok4,5, Jan Mejzlík4,5
1Department of Military Internal Medicine and Military Hygiene, Military Faculty of Medicine, University of Defence, Czech Republic. kristyna.nema@fnhk.cz.
概括
耳硬化手术可以暂时减少骨传导,大多数患者恢复听力. 诸如年龄和最初的骨传导水平等因素影响恢复,而早期的高频损失预测永久性听力损失.

背景情况:
- 耳硬化手术带有手术创伤的风险,导致骨传导减少.
- 了解骨传导变化后的骨硬化手术对于患者管理至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 为了评估骨硬化手术后的骨传导改变.
- 确定导致术后骨传导能力下降的因素.
主要方法:
- 对109名接受耳硬化手术的患者进行了回顾性分析.
- 纯音调听力测量在手术前和手术后2天,1个月,1年评估.
主要成果:
- 28%的患者在术后第二天经历了>5dB的骨导电减少,9%的患者在1年后表现出持续的损失.
- 永久性骨传导损失的更高风险与早期高频率损失,年龄较大和手术前骨传导值>20dB有关.
- 修复手术并不是骨传导损失的重要因素.
结论:
- 骨髓硬化术后的骨传导率下降通常是短暂的.
- 患者的年龄和手术前的骨传导水平会影响听力恢复.
- 早期术后高频率的骨传导减少是永久性听力损失的负面预测因素.

The Cochlea
44.5K
The cochlea is a coiled structure in the inner ear that contains hair cells—the sensory receptors of the auditory system. Sound waves are transmitted to the cochlea by small bones attached to the eardrum called the ossicles, which vibrate the oval window that leads to the inner ear. This causes fluid in the chambers of the cochlea to move, vibrating the basilar membrane.
